Summary
Keep feed mill operations running efficiently by ensuring the right ingredients are in the right place at the right time. As a Feed Ingredient Coordinator, you will manage ingredient inventory levels, coordinate inbound deliveries, and partner with suppliers, transportation providers, and internal teams to maintain a reliable supply chain. You will also support freight payment processing, supplier compliance, and feed mill documentation to help drive operational excellence. Principal Essential Duties & Responsibilities
- Manage and communicate ingredient inventory levels across feed mill locations, proactively identifying and addressing discrepancies to ensure accuracy and availability.
- Schedule inbound ingredient deliveries to Perdue feed mills, balancing vendor availability, logistical constraints, and operational priorities.
- Serve as the key point of contact for suppliers, ensuring timely and efficient execution of delivery schedules.
- Review, validate, and approve freight-related invoices and payments in the Direct Stamp Approval System.
- Enter load data into the transportation dispatch system.
- Administer and manage Supplier Survey Forms for the Process Verified Program, ensuring supplier compliance with corporate and regulatory standards.
- Manage, maintain, and update feed mill profile documentation, ensuring accurate representation of mill capabilities.
